Accessibility and Mental Health: A Critical Intersection

The World Health Organization estimates that over 264 million people worldwide suffer from depression, yet barriers such as stigma, geographic isolation, and limited access to specialized care persist (WHO, 2021). Digital interventions, especially those accessible via mobile browsers, serve as critical adjuncts or even primary sources of support for many individuals.

Unlike dedicated apps that demand downloads and often require specific device compatibility, mobile browser-based tools remove barriers related to storage, compatibility, and privacy concerns. This allows users to engage with mental health practices or mindfulness exercises instantaneously, often in their preferred environment, fostering consistent habits.

The Role of Digital Wellness Tools in Behavior Change

Research from the Digital Wellness Institute suggests that immediate, accessible tools significantly increase user engagement time and adherence rates. Specifically, tools that are platform-agnostic and require minimal setup correlate with higher sustained usage. For example, a recent survey found that 65% of participants preferred browser-based resources over app installations for quick stress relief (DWI, 2023).

The Future of Digital Wellness: Norms and Best Practices

To remain effective and inclusive, digital wellness tools must adhere to evolving standards such as the Web Content Accessibility Guidelines (WCAG) and incorporate user feedback driven by diverse populations. A well-designed mobile web experience encapsulates:

  • Simplicity of interface for cognitive ease
  • Minimalistic design for quick loading times
  • Multilevel customization to suit different needs
  • Seamless integration with other health data platforms

These design principles not only enhance user engagement but also promote sustained mental health practices during moments of crisis or routine maintenance of emotional balance.
